Why Storage Matters for Natural Blue Coloring for Frosting and Other Applications

When working with natural pigments, especially those derived from spirulina, the way they are stored directly influences their performance. A food coloring company that specializes in natural extracts understands that light, temperature, and humidity are the primary enemies of color stability. For those seeking the best no taste food coloring, spirulina-based blue offers a remarkable alternative to synthetic dyes, but only if the powder or liquid concentrate is kept under proper conditions. The natural blue coloring for frosting, for instance, can shift in hue from a vibrant sky blue to a muted greenish tone if exposed to direct sunlight over time. This is because the phycocyanin molecules in spirulina are photosensitive. By controlling storage variables, users can maintain the original intensity and clarity of the color. Practical storage tips include using opaque, airtight containers and placing them in a cool, dry cupboard away from heat sources like ovens or stovetops. Many home bakers have reported that when they follow these guidelines, the pigment remains true to its original shade for up to 18 months. However, specific effectiveness depends on circumstances, so it is wise to test a small batch before large-scale use. Ultimately, understanding the science behind pigment preservation empowers consumers to get consistent, reliable results every time they reach for that jar of natural colorant.

How Temperature Fluctuations Affect Your Natural Blue Coloring for Frosting

Temperature is one of the most critical variables when storing spirulina-based colorants. A single cycle of freezing and thawing, or prolonged exposure to heat above 40 degrees Celsius, can degrade the phycocyanin complex, causing the natural blue coloring for frosting to lose its vividness and turn dull. For those seeking the best no taste food coloring, maintaining a consistent temperature is key to preserving both the visual appeal and the neutral flavor profile. A food coloring company that offers spirulina extracts typically recommends storing them in a location that remains below 25 degrees Celsius, such as a pantry or a cabinet away from the refrigerator's heat exhaust. If you live in a region with high seasonal temperature swings, consider using a climate-controlled storage bin to buffer against extremes. Bakers and food artisans have found that even small deviations, like leaving the container on a sunny countertop for a few hours, can cause irreversible changes to the pigment. To avoid this, always return the colorant to its dark, cool spot immediately after use. Some users also refrigerate the powder during hot summer months, but only if the container is completely sealed to prevent condensation from clumping the powder. While these measures help, the exact outcome can vary; the experience of each user is unique, and external conditions like the pH of the frosting can also interact with the color. So while general guidance is solid, testing has shown that individual results depend on how closely the storage instructions are followed. The key takeaway is that temperature management is a simple yet powerful way to keep your natural blues brilliant and your baked goods looking professional.

Why Choosing the Right Container Is Essential for Maintaining Spirulina Quality

The container you use for storing spirulina-based colorants plays a pivotal role in preserving their quality. Glass jars with airtight seals are generally the best choice because they are non-reactive and do not let any odors or moisture pass through. A food coloring company that sells the best no taste food coloring often uses Mylar bags with one-way valves during initial packaging, but once you open the product, transferring it to a dark glass jar is a wise move. The natural blue coloring for frosting can lose its potency if stored in plastic containers that allow gas exchange over time. Additionally, avoid using containers that have previously held strong-smelling foods, like coffee or pickles, as the spirulina powder will absorb those residues. Opt for small containers that match your usage frequency; for instance, if you bake once a week, a 50-gram jar might be more suitable than a 500-gram bulk container that you open repeatedly. Each time you open the jar, fresh air enters, speeding up oxidation. Some advanced users use a vacuum sealer attachment for jars to remove air before storage, which can dramatically extend the shelf life. The food coloring company's laboratory tests indicate that proper container choice can maintain color strength for over 24 months under ideal conditions. However, because household environments vary, the results will not be uniform for everyone. It is recommended to label your container with the product name and date, and to check the color periodically. If the blue appears slightly greenish or less vibrant, it may be time to replace the stock. By investing in the right storage vessels, you are taking an important step toward getting consistent, high-quality performance from your natural colorants, batch after batch.

Expert Insights from a Food Coloring Company on Humidity and Light Control

Humidity and light are two factors that a food coloring company emphasizes in its educational materials for natural spirulina extracts. Spirulina is a hygroscopic substance, meaning it readily absorbs moisture from the air. If the relative humidity in your storage area exceeds 60%, the powder can clump and eventually develop mold, which will ruin both the color and the safety of the product. The best no taste food coloring relies on the purity of the spirulina, and any moisture can trigger a breakdown of the phycocyanin, leading to a brownish tint. For the natural blue coloring for frosting, exposure to UV light from sunlight or fluorescent bulbs can cause photobleaching, where the blue fades to a pale gray or beige. To combat this, store the colorant in a cupboard that is not frequently opened, or use opaque containers. Some food coloring companies offer amber or cobalt blue glass jars specifically designed to block light while allowing you to see the product level. If you live in a humid climate, consider including a desiccant pack in the storage jar, but change it monthly because it will become saturated. Another tip is to avoid storing the container near a window or under a skylight. The company's own quality control tests have shown that spirulina stored in a dark, dry environment at 20 degrees Celsius retains more than 90% of its original color intensity after one year, whereas samples left in a bright, humid room lost half their vibrancy in just six months. These findings underscore the importance of environment. As with all natural products, individual outcomes may differ based on the specific storage conditions and handling practices. Therefore, it is sensible to purchase smaller quantities if you are new to using natural colorants, and gradually increase your supply as you become familiar with how to care for them. With proper humidity and light control, your natural blue can stay bright and your best no taste food coloring will remain ready for any creative baking project.

Adapting Storage Methods for Bulk Users Who Want the Best No Taste Food Coloring

For bakeries, cafes, or home enthusiasts who buy spirulina colorants in bulk, storage requires additional planning. A food coloring company often provides bulk packaging with double-sealed liners, but once you open a large bag, the clock starts ticking. To preserve the best no taste food coloring qualities, divide the bulk product into smaller, daily-use portions. The natural blue coloring for frosting can be stored in vacuum-sealed bags or glass jars with oxygen absorbers. Label each portion with the date of dividing and the expected use-by date, which is typically six months from when the bulk bag was opened. If you have a walk-in pantry or a dedicated dry-storage area, keep it in a dark corner away from heat-producing equipment like ovens or refrigeration compressors. Bulk users may also benefit from investing in a temperature and humidity data logger to monitor the environment. If the powder shows signs of caking or color shift, use the affected portion first in recipes where slight variations are less noticeable, such as in batters or doughs. A food coloring company's research suggests that the phycocyanin content begins to degrade slowly after opening, so rotating your stock is crucial. Use a first-in, first-out system to ensure older product is used before newer stock. One bakery owner found that by storing his bulk spirulina in a refrigerated wine cabinet set to 12 degrees Celsius, the colorant remained stable for over 18 months. However, such results are not guaranteed and will vary depending on the specific product and storage conditions. Always test the color in a small sample of frosting before applying it to a full batch. By adopting these bulk storage strategies, you can minimize waste and keep your production consistent, ensuring that every customer receives the same high-quality, naturally colored treats.
